Nissan Rogue: Underbody - Cleaning exterior - Appearance and care - Nissan Rogue Owner's ManualNissan Rogue: Underbody

In areas where road salt is used in winter, the underbody must be cleaned regularly. This will prevent dirt and salt from building up and causing the acceleration of corrosion on the underbody and suspension. Before the winter period and again in the spring, the underseal must be checked and, if necessary, re-treated.
